[PATCH] clk: socfpga: Map the clk manager base address in the clock driver

dinguyen at altera.com dinguyen at altera.com
Mon Dec 9 14:30:47 EST 2013


From: Dinh Nguyen <dinguyen at altera.com>

The clk manager's base address was being mapped in SOCFPGA's arch code and
being extern'ed out to the clock driver. This method is not correct, and the
arch code was not really doing anything with that clk manager anyways.

This patch moves the mapping of the clk manager's base address in the clock
driver itself.
